Competition Commission v Guiricich Bros Construction (Pty) Ltd (016972) [2013] ZACT 77 (23 July 2013)

Competition Commission v Guiricich Bros Construction (Pty) Ltd (016972) [2013] ZACT 77 (23 July 2013)

The Tribunal found that Giuricich Bros Construction (Pty) Ltd admitted to engaging in collusive tendering in contravention of section 4(1)(b)(iii) of the Competition Act, specifically in relation to the Millwood Village Residential Project. The respondent provided full and expeditious cooperation, disclosed all relevant information, and undertook to cease prohibited practices and implement a compliance programme. The administrative penalty was calculated in accordance with the Invitation and the Act. The Tribunal confirmed the consent agreement as an order, concluding all proceedings between the Commission and Giuricich Bros Construction (Pty) Ltd in respect of the disclosed conduct.

Orders

  • The consent agreement between the Competition Commission and Giuricich Bros Construction (Pty) Ltd is confirmed as an order of the Tribunal.
  • Giuricich Bros Construction (Pty) Ltd shall pay an administrative penalty of R3,552,568 in two equal instalments: R1,776,284 on or before 31 July 2013, and R1,776,284 on or before 31 August 2014.
